Darlene Fedoroshyn

Executive Director International Markets at Travel Alberta

Darlene Fedoroshyn has extensive experience in the tourism industry, starting as a Travel Consultant at Navigant International from 1993 to 1998. Darlene then worked as a Tourism Marketing and Sales Coordinator at Canada Olympic Park from 1999 to 2003, where they promoted tourism products and secured bookings. From 2003 to 2007, Darlene served as the Manager of International Sales at Tourism Calgary, where they managed marketing tactics and budgets and developed cooperative programs with key tour operator accounts. Darlene then joined Travel Alberta in 2007 and held various roles, including Marketing Director for Europe & Australia from 2007 to 2013 and Marketing Director for Asia from 2013 to 2016. In these positions, they developed and implemented marketing strategies, established relationships with industry partners, and contributed to revenue and visitation growth from various markets. Since 2016, Darlene has been serving as the Director of Business Development at Travel Alberta.

Darlene Fedoroshyn attended Mount Royal University from 2017 to 2019, where they studied Strategic Management. Prior to that, they obtained a Bachelor of Arts (BA) degree in Leisure Tourism and Society from the University of Calgary, which they attended from 1989 to 1993. Darlene's earlier education is not specified, but it is known that they attended Sir Winston Churchill school at some point, although the years and the field of study are unknown.

Tourism is a major driver of Alberta’s economy. And it’s not just front-line tourism businesses who play a role – a diverse range of industries and jobs across the province benefit from the visitors who come to Alberta. Travel Alberta is the destination management organization of the Government of Alberta. We promote Alberta as a desirable place to travel, work, live, play, invest and learn. Working with businesses throughout the province, we capitalize on Alberta’s breathtaking landscapes and world-class hospitality to develop memorable experiences for visitors to enjoy, in all regions, in all seasons. Our work directly and indirectly benefits our province, driving visitation and revenue, diversifying the economy, providing jobs, encouraging economic investment and enhancing quality of life for Albertans and their communities. Established as a Crown corporation on April 1, 2009, we operate under the authority of the Travel Alberta Act within the Ministry of Economic Development, Trade and Tourism.
